Local on sub

Submariners make up only 10% of the U.S. Navy’s personnel, but they play a critical role in carrying out one of the Defense Department’s most important missions: strategic deterrence.

Lt. j.g. Lee Adler, a native of Silverdale, is one of the sailors supporting a 123-year tradition of service under the sea to help ensure Americans’ safety. Adler joined the Navy 13 years ago and now serves with Commander, Submarine Group 10.

Known as America’s “Apex Predators!,” the Navy’s submarine force operates a large fleet of technically-advanced vessels. These submarines are capable of conducting rapid defensive and offensive operations around the world, in furtherance of U.S. national security. “What makes me proud is being a part of the finest officer community that the Department of Defense has to offer as a Navy Mustang, which is an officer that has risen up from the enlisted ranks,” Adler said.

He added: “Being in the Navy is my way to serve the people of this great nation. I’d like to thank my wife and children who are the center of my life. Without their support, I couldn’t do what I do in the Navy.”
